Methodology for Testing Durability

To test the durability of aluminum sunshade stitching under repeated tension, a series of controlled experiments are conducted. These tests typically involve:

1. Material Selection: Choosing high-quality aluminum fabric and stitching materials that are known for their strength and resistance to wear.

2. Environmental Setup: Creating a controlled environment that simulates real-world conditions, including temperature fluctuations and exposure to UV rays.

3. Tension Application: Applying repeated tension to the stitching using specialized equipment designed for this purpose.

4. Data Collection: Monitoring changes in the stitching over time through regular inspections and measurements.

Results and Analysis

The results of these tests provide valuable insights into the performance of aluminum sunshade stitching under repeated tension. Key factors that are analyzed include:

- Stitch Breakage Rate: The number of stitches that break over a given period.

- Stitch Strength: The amount of force required to break a single stitch.

- Fabric Integrity: Any signs of wear or damage on the fabric around the stitching area.

These findings help manufacturers improve their products by identifying areas where enhancements can be made to increase durability.
